Hiking around Nonsard-Lamarche offers diverse landscapes within Lorraine, France, characterized by expansive lakes, protected nature reserves, and rolling countryside. The region features significant natural elements like Lac de Madine, a large artificial lake, and Étang de Lachaussée, a protected wetland habitat. Trails often combine natural scenery with historical sites, including remnants from World War I. This area provides a variety of hiking trails suitable for different preferences and abilities.

Lac de Madine is an artificial lake of almost 10 km², created in the 1970s as a water reservoir for the city of Metz. It is located in the heart of the Lorraine Regional Nature Park and is part of the Natura 2000 network for its ecological value. The lake has two islands, 250 hectares of forest and 42 km of shoreline. In addition to its role in the drinking water supply, it is an important recreational area with two main sites: Nonsard-Lamarche and Heudicourt-sous-les-Côtes. Visitors will find marinas, beaches, cycle and walking routes, restaurants and nature reserves.

The current church of Montsec was built in 1929, replacing an older church dating from 1723 that was badly damaged during the First World War. The original church had been restored in 1900, but was completely destroyed during the fighting around the Saint-Mihiel salient. The new church is dedicated to Saint Lucy, patron saint of light, and is a symbol of reconstruction in a village that was almost completely destroyed between 1914 and 1918.

Nonsard Beach offers a supervised swimming area, ideal for cooling off with friends or family. The beach benefits from the direct proximity of the aqua park, the beach bar, and the playgrounds. Access to the beach is free, and restrooms are available behind the playgrounds.

The port of Nonsard accommodates 280 boats afloat. Located on Lake Madine, sailors enjoy the lake's 900 hectares to practice their sport in a splendid environment.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available in Nonsard-Lamarche?

There are over 75 hiking routes available around Nonsard-Lamarche, offering a diverse range of experiences. These include easy lakeside strolls and more moderate routes through varied terrain.

What kind of terrain can I expect on hikes around Nonsard-Lamarche?

The terrain around Nonsard-Lamarche is quite varied. You'll find paths through expansive forests, rolling countryside, and scenic waterside promenades around large lakes like Lake Madine and the protected Lachaussée Pond. Some routes also incorporate historical elements, with views of former battlefields.

What do other hikers enjoy most about hiking in Nonsard-Lamarche?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 170 reviews. Hikers often praise the beautiful views of Lac de Madine, the tranquility of the nature reserves, and the blend of natural scenery with historical sites.

Are there any significant historical sites to see while hiking in Nonsard-Lamarche?

Yes, hiking in Nonsard-Lamarche offers a unique opportunity to explore historical sites. Trails often pass by remnants from World War I, including visible trenches. The Montsec American Memorial is a prominent landmark, offering panoramic views of the landscape and former battlefields.

What natural features can I explore on hikes in Nonsard-Lamarche?

The region is rich in natural beauty, centered around Lac de Madine, a large artificial lake with 42 km of shoreline, and the Lachaussée Pond, a protected nature reserve. These areas are part of the Natura 2000 network and offer opportunities to observe diverse wildlife, including birds, amphibians, and various plant life in wetland habitats.

Are there good viewpoints along the hiking trails?

Many trails offer excellent viewpoints. For instance, routes around Lac de Madine provide scenic vistas of the lake. The Montsec American Memorial, situated on a hill, offers expansive panoramic views of the surrounding landscape, including the lake and the Woëvre plain.

Are there any easy hiking trails su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Nonsard-Lamarche has over 20 easy hiking routes. A great option for a pleasant stroll is the Marina at Lac de Madine – Lac de Madine loop from Nonsard-Lamarche, an easy 7.4 km path that provides a gentle walk around the marina and along the lake shores.

Can I bring my dog on the hiking trails in Nonsard-Lamarche?

Generally, dogs are welcome on many trails in the natural areas around Nonsard-Lamarche. However, it's always advisable to keep them on a leash, especially in protected nature reserves like Lachaussée Regional Nature Reserve, to protect local wildlife and ensure a pleasant experience for all hikers.

Are there circular hiking routes available?

Yes, many of the hiking routes in Nonsard-Lamarche are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Beautiful view of Lac de Madine – Étang des Nouettes loop from Heudicourt-sous-les-Côtes, a moderate 12.3 km trail offering scenic views.

What is the best season for hiking in Nonsard-Lamarche?

Nonsard-Lamarche offers enjoyable hiking experiences thro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ery with blooming flora or vibrant fall colors. Summer is also popular, especially around Lac de Madine, though it can be warmer. Winter hikes are possible, offering a different, often tranquil, perspective of the landscape.

Are there any moderate hikes that offer a good challenge?

Yes, there are over 50 moderate routes. The Madine Lake Marina – Lake Madine loop from Nonsard-Lamarche is an 8.1 miles (13.0 km) trail that leads through varied terrain around the lake, providing a good moderate challenge.

Where can I find parking for hiking trails in Nonsard-Lamarche?

Parking is generally available at key access points around popular areas like Lac de Madine, particularly near the marina (Port of Nonsard) and other recreational facilities. For specific trailheads, it's recommended to check the route details on komoot for designated parking areas.
